However, before you decide to add one to your child's room, you must ensure that the treehouse will be safe and secure. This is why you should consult an arborist or someone with similar expertise prior to beginning construction. They can assess if the existing tree is sturdy enough to support the structure, and provide suggestions on the kind of supports that will be required.

In general, it is recommended to keep the structure as lightweight as possible to ensure that you don't put too much strain on the tree. The heavier your treehouse is and the more support you will need to keep it stable and the higher the chance of damage. If you are planning to add furniture or other heavy objects it is a good idea to use a sturdy platform made of deck boards made of plywood. You can build it using cedar or other materials that are durable for a more advanced build. You should also construct a railing, and if possible, have a ladder or staircase attached to ensure security.
